⚙️Technical Roadmap: Why Oil-Immersed Technology Trumps Dry-Type in Osaka

The core of our technology lies in the Inductive Voltage Regulation mechanism. While dry-type stabilizers are suitable for indoor, low-power office environments, the industrial sectors of Osaka require the robustness of oil immersion. Here is the technical breakdown of our competitive edge:

  • Thermal Management: Using high-grade transformer oil, our stabilizers can operate at 100% duty cycle even in unventilated factory corners. The oil acts as both an insulator and a cooling medium, circulating heat away from the core components.
  • Step-less Regulation: Our servo-controlled systems provide smooth, continuous voltage adjustment without the "step jumps" found in lower-end magnetic stabilizers, ensuring the safety of delicate medical and laboratory equipment used in Osaka’s university hospitals.
  • Corrosion Resistance: The sealed oil tank design protects the internal copper windings from the salty, humid air of the Osaka Bay area, significantly extending the lifespan of the equipment to over 20 years.

Frequently Asked Questions (FAQ)

What is the typical lifespan of an oil-immersed stabilizer in an industrial environment?

With proper maintenance and biennial oil quality checks, our industrial-grade oil-immersed stabilizers typically last 20 to 25 years, significantly longer than dry-type alternatives.

Can you provide custom input/output voltages for specific Osaka machinery?

Yes. We specialize in non-standard configurations. Whether you need 200V, 220V, 380V, or 440V step-up or step-down stabilization, our engineering team can design a solution specifically for your equipment's load profile.

How does the "oil-cooled" mechanism handle high-intensity harmonic distortion?

The high thermal mass of the transformer oil helps absorb and dissipate heat generated by harmonic currents (often caused by large VFDs and welders), preventing the core from overheating and maintaining a stable output waveform.
